How to Fasten a Double Rivet
Rivets are metal fasteners that hold two items together. Rivets are useful in leather working attachments and in craftwork at junctions. A double rivet has a flat head on the exterior of each end for a finished appearance on both the wrong and right side of crafts and work. Rivets are available at craft shops in several sizes to accommodate different thicknesses of materials.
Instructions
-
-
1
Slide a rivet into a hole-punch tube to determine the correct size on the hole punch. The rivet will slide into the tube on the correct size.
-
2
Turn the correct hole-punch tube so that it faces straight down on the punch.
-
-
3
Place one of the pieces of material or leather in a hole punch at the area of the junction.
-
4
Squeeze both handles of the hole punch to puncture through the material or leather.
-
5
Place the second item of material to attach underneath the first one with the hole in it.
-
6
Place the second item of material to attach underneath the first one with the hole in it.
-
7
Mark a dot in the hole with a marker on the second item where they will join.
-
8
Punch a hole in the second piece of leather or material on the mark.
-
9
Set one piece of material on top of the other while aligning the holes in each.
-
10
Lift the materials to slide the pointed half of a double rivet through both holes from underneath with the point facing up.
-
11
Center the other flat half of the double rivet on top of the point and slightly press down with a hand to hold it in place.
-
12
Place a rivet setter on the rivet so that the bottom jaw is underneath the bottom half and the top jaw is over the top half. Squeeze both handles together to join the two halves securely.

Tips & Warnings
Make certain that the hole is the correct size for the rivet, or the junction will be too tight and bind materials, or too loose and not hold securely.
Thicker materials like leather require more force when punching holes in them. A hole punch will puncture through two thinner cloth materials at one time.
Double rivets are available in silver and gold tones as well as copper at craft stores.
Double rivet kits are available with the correct size setting tool included in the purchase.
